SUMMER HEATS UP WITH FAVORITE SPORTS AND FEATURES ON UNIVERSAL HD

BURBANK, Calif. -� June 1, 2006 �- Summer heats up when Universal HD brings viewers the scariest moments from the beach. Beware The Beach Weekend (Friday, July 7th through Sunday, July 9th) features the high definition premiere of The Triangle. Set against the mysteries of the Bermuda Triangle, this three-night, SCI FI original miniseries focuses on a disparate group of professionals brought together to investigate the dangerous truths behind one of the greatest legends of our time. The critically-acclaimed series airs Friday at 9pm and 1:30am and Saturday and Sunday at 9pm and 1am (ET). The weekend also features Waterworld, Jaws 2, Gray Lady Down, Moon Over Parador and special episodes of Medical Investigation and Surface.

Universal digs up the Weekend of The Living Sequels from Friday, July 28th through Sunday, July 30th. Hitchhikers, giant man-eating worms and a psychotic cross-dresser return to torment viewers all weekend long. On Friday, Universal HD features Psycho IV: The Beginning, The Hitcher II and Darkman III. Saturday features Tremors, Tremors IV and Skulls III and Sunday concludes with Jaws 2 � all in high defnition.

The third show of the new series, The 2006 Jeep World of Adventure Sports HD, premieres on Friday, July 21st at 10pm and 1am (ET). This episode takes us paragliding above the Alps, first descents on Mount Waddington in British Columbia, and deep snow roadside skiing with the TGR Ski Team. The 2006 JWOASHD is a new action-adventure sports series premiering on Universal HD, hosted by Pat Parnell. Shot in native 1080i HD, the show features an array of adrenaline-inspired feats and adventurous sporting events from around the world. Anchor events will be complemented by behind-the-scenes features on athletes, expeditions and the world of action-adventure sports.

Nothing says summer like live sports events � in high definition. Universal HD will broadcast The 2006 Dew Action Sports Tour live on Friday, July 14th and Saturday, July 15th at 12am (ET). Featured in this installment is The Right Guard Open, the second stop on the 2006 tour.
